Law Offices of Howard G. Smith announces a November 9, 2009, deadline to move to be a lead plaintiff in the securities class action lawsuit filed on behalf of all persons or entities who purchased the common stock of Pacific Capital Bancorp (the "Company")(Nasdaq:PCBC) between April 30, 2009 and July 30, 2009, inclusive (the "Class Period"). The shareholder lawsuit is pending in the United States District Court for the Central District of California.
The Complaint charges Pacific Capital Bancorp and certain of the Company's executive officers, among others, with violations of federal securities laws. Pacific Capital Bancorp is a bank holding company and the ...
